Fantasy football managers are advised to exercise patience with rookie running back Jonathon Brooks and receiver Jaylin Noel during Week 1 of the 2026 season. Brooks enters his debut following two ACL surgeries and remains behind Chuba Hubbard on the Carolina Panthers depth chart. While Brooks shows potential and faces a favorable matchup against the Chicago Bears, analysts indicate he has not yet earned a heavy workload. Similarly, Jaylin Noel is currently unranked for his opening game with Houston against Buffalo. Despite a track record of scoring production and a potential path to targets behind Brock Bowers, experts suggest waiting to see how the receiver usage settles on the field before starting him. Both players currently present too much uncertainty for immediate fantasy consideration in opening lineups.
